متن کاملDeployment of a Large-scale Peer-to-Peer Social Network
We present the design and architecture of the Maze filesharing and social network. Maze is one of the first large-scale deployments of an academic research project, with over 210,000 registered users and more than 10,000 users online at any time, sharing over 140 million files.
